summ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--crawl-ref/source/describe.cc4
-rw-r--r--crawl-ref/source/fight.cc6
-rw-r--r--crawl-ref/source/item_use.cc2
-rw-r--r--crawl-ref/source/mon-cast.cc2
-rw-r--r--crawl-ref/source/player.cc13
-rw-r--r--crawl-ref/source/player.h1
-rw-r--r--crawl-ref/source/transfor.cc4
-rw-r--r--crawl-ref/source/view.cc2
-rw-r--r--crawl-ref/source/xom.cc2
9 files changed, 15 insertions, 21 deletions
diff --git a/crawl-ref/source/describe.cc b/crawl-ref/source/describe.cc
index 6d5b42bf67..5754d81332 100644
--- a/crawl-ref/source/describe.cc
+++ b/crawl-ref/source/describe.cc
@@ -3737,7 +3737,7 @@ std::string get_skill_description(int skill, bool need_title)
if (you.attribute[ATTR_TRANSFORMATION] == TRAN_DRAGON
|| player_genus(GENPC_DRACONIAN)
- || you.species == SP_MERFOLK && player_is_swimming()
+ || you.species == SP_MERFOLK && you.swimming()
|| player_mutation_level( MUT_STINGER ))
{
// TSO worshippers will not use their venomous tails.
@@ -3766,7 +3766,7 @@ std::string get_skill_description(int skill, bool need_title)
else if (player_mutation_level(MUT_TALONS))
unarmed_attacks.push_back("claw with your talons");
else if (you.species != SP_NAGA
- && (you.species != SP_MERFOLK || !player_is_swimming()))
+ && (you.species != SP_MERFOLK || !you.swimming()))
{
unarmed_attacks.push_back("deliver a kick");
}
diff --git a/crawl-ref/source/fight.cc b/crawl-ref/source/fight.cc
index 77b954b513..3d88c58563 100644
--- a/crawl-ref/source/fight.cc
+++ b/crawl-ref/source/fight.cc
@@ -239,7 +239,7 @@ int calc_heavy_armour_penalty( bool random_factor )
// Wearing heavy armour in water is particularly cumbersome.
if (you.species == SP_MERFOLK && grd(you.pos()) == DNGN_DEEP_WATER
- && player_is_swimming())
+ && you.swimming())
{
ev_pen *= 2;
}
@@ -985,7 +985,7 @@ bool melee_attack::player_aux_unarmed()
if ((you.attribute[ATTR_TRANSFORMATION] == TRAN_DRAGON
|| player_genus(GENPC_DRACONIAN)
- || (you.species == SP_MERFOLK && player_is_swimming())
+ || (you.species == SP_MERFOLK && you.swimming())
|| player_mutation_level(MUT_STINGER))
&& one_chance_in(3))
{
@@ -1098,7 +1098,7 @@ bool melee_attack::player_aux_unarmed()
{
// not draconian, and not wet merfolk
if (!player_genus(GENPC_DRACONIAN)
- && !(you.species == SP_MERFOLK && player_is_swimming())
+ && !(you.species == SP_MERFOLK && you.swimming())
&& !player_mutation_level(MUT_STINGER)
|| (!one_chance_in(4)))
diff --git a/crawl-ref/source/item_use.cc b/crawl-ref/source/item_use.cc
index 371e407330..3380880fd1 100644
--- a/crawl-ref/source/item_use.cc
+++ b/crawl-ref/source/item_use.cc
@@ -853,7 +853,7 @@ bool can_wear_armour(const item_def &item, bool verbose, bool ignore_temporary)
return (false);
}
- if (!ignore_temporary && player_is_swimming()
+ if (!ignore_temporary && you.swimming()
&& you.species == SP_MERFOLK)
{
if (verbose)
diff --git a/crawl-ref/source/mon-cast.cc b/crawl-ref/source/mon-cast.cc
index 4f877ae5c0..a9535cea2e 100644
--- a/crawl-ref/source/mon-cast.cc
+++ b/crawl-ref/source/mon-cast.cc
@@ -1382,7 +1382,7 @@ static void _do_high_level_summon(monsters *monster, bool monsterNearby,
static bool _legs_msg_applicable()
{
return (you.species != SP_NAGA
- && (you.species != SP_MERFOLK || !player_is_swimming()));
+ && (you.species != SP_MERFOLK || !you.swimming()));
}
void mons_cast_haunt(monsters *monster)
diff --git a/crawl-ref/source/player.cc b/crawl-ref/source/player.cc
index 43c6fedeae..e0a768146c 100644
--- a/crawl-ref/source/player.cc
+++ b/crawl-ref/source/player.cc
@@ -428,11 +428,6 @@ bool player_likes_water(bool permanently)
return (player_can_swim() || (!permanently && beogh_water_walk()));
}
-bool player_is_swimming()
-{
- return (you.swimming());
-}
-
bool player_in_bat_form()
{
return (you.attribute[ATTR_TRANSFORMATION] == TRAN_BAT);
@@ -692,7 +687,7 @@ bool you_tran_can_wear(int eq, bool check_mutation)
return (false);
if (eq == EQ_BOOTS
- && (player_is_swimming() && you.species == SP_MERFOLK
+ && (you.swimming() && you.species == SP_MERFOLK
|| player_mutation_level(MUT_HOOVES)
|| player_mutation_level(MUT_TALONS)))
{
@@ -1867,7 +1862,7 @@ int player_movement_speed(void)
{
int mv = 10;
- if (player_is_swimming())
+ if (you.swimming())
{
// This is swimming... so it doesn't make sense to really
// apply the other things (the mutation is "cover ground",
@@ -4051,7 +4046,7 @@ void display_char_status()
const int move_cost = (player_speed() * player_movement_speed()) / 10;
const bool water = player_in_water();
- const bool swim = player_is_swimming();
+ const bool swim = you.swimming();
const bool lev = you.airborne();
const bool fly = (you.flight_mode() == FL_FLY);
@@ -6173,7 +6168,7 @@ std::string player::foot_name(bool plural, bool *can_plural) const
str = "underbelly";
*can_plural = false;
}
- else if (this->species == SP_MERFOLK && player_is_swimming())
+ else if (this->species == SP_MERFOLK && you.swimming())
{
str = "tail";
*can_plural = false;
diff --git a/crawl-ref/source/player.h b/crawl-ref/source/player.h
index 827d8788de..d62a4affdc 100644
--- a/crawl-ref/source/player.h
+++ b/crawl-ref/source/player.h
@@ -538,7 +538,6 @@ bool is_light_armour( const item_def &item );
bool player_light_armour(bool with_skill = false);
bool player_in_water(void);
-bool player_is_swimming(void);
bool player_under_penance(void);
diff --git a/crawl-ref/source/transfor.cc b/crawl-ref/source/transfor.cc
index b2b2bec286..3127308325 100644
--- a/crawl-ref/source/transfor.cc
+++ b/crawl-ref/source/transfor.cc
@@ -532,7 +532,7 @@ bool transform(int pow, transformation_type which_trans, bool force,
return (false);
}
- if (you.species == SP_MERFOLK && player_is_swimming()
+ if (you.species == SP_MERFOLK && you.swimming()
&& which_trans != TRAN_DRAGON && which_trans != TRAN_BAT)
{
// This might be overkill, but it's okay because obviously
@@ -672,7 +672,7 @@ bool transform(int pow, transformation_type which_trans, bool force,
symbol = 'D';
colour = GREEN;
dur = std::min(20 + random2(pow) + random2(pow), 100);
- if (you.species == SP_MERFOLK && player_is_swimming())
+ if (you.species == SP_MERFOLK && you.swimming())
{
msg = "You fly out of the water as you turn into "
"a fearsome dragon!";
diff --git a/crawl-ref/source/view.cc b/crawl-ref/source/view.cc
index 9156ea8ca3..4b4ad25e4d 100644
--- a/crawl-ref/source/view.cc
+++ b/crawl-ref/source/view.cc
@@ -1751,7 +1751,7 @@ void viewwindow(bool draw_it, bool do_updates)
buffy[bufcount] = you.symbol;
buffy[bufcount + 1] = you.colour;
- if (player_is_swimming())
+ if (you.swimming())
{
if (grd(gc) == DNGN_DEEP_WATER)
buffy[bufcount + 1] = BLUE;
diff --git a/crawl-ref/source/xom.cc b/crawl-ref/source/xom.cc
index a1f0b98fcc..05a51fcc82 100644
--- a/crawl-ref/source/xom.cc
+++ b/crawl-ref/source/xom.cc
@@ -2475,7 +2475,7 @@ static void _xom_zero_miscast()
}
if (you.species != SP_NAGA
- && (you.species != SP_MERFOLK || !player_is_swimming())
+ && (you.species != SP_MERFOLK || !you.swimming())
&& !you.airborne())
{
messages.push_back("You do an impromptu tapdance.");